Transaction 709b7950a9ed226c2460957767e17c9c97a3ed58ee880a8866227763dada8207
1 Input
2 Outputs
- 709b7950a9ed226c2460957767e17c9c97a3ed58ee880a8866227763dada8207:0
- 709b7950a9ed226c2460957767e17c9c97a3ed58ee880a8866227763dada8207:1
value 466929
address 1JUyQaf8pfAKwgQ7ms91r9TvdPDZMDMtW4
value 10378077
address 17eeWXLYppF3dc9vP5zxVhB8h3ZUAdsw6F